Comparison Analysis

Cox College graduates earn $58,703, while Lawrence Technological University graduates earn $58,827. Cox College has a 71.4% acceptance rate, and Lawrence Technological University has an 80.3% acceptance rate. Cox College's tuition is $15,599, and Lawrence Technological University's tuition is $41,872.
